You should seek prompt medical attention if you experience: Symptoms of advanced liver disease , including jaundice (yellowing of skin or eyes), persistent abdominal swelling, confusion or altered mental state, easy bruising or bleeding, or dark urine with pale stools Unexplained symptoms such as severe fatigue, unintentional weight loss, persistent nausea, or abdominal pain, particularly in the right upper quadrant Signs of complications , including vomiting blood, black tarry stools, or swelling in the legs and ankles Your healthcare provider will likely arrange further investigations to clarify the cause of elevated B12 and assess liver function
